Non-combatant pets
Do non-combatant pets do anything except look good? I thought they might carry items but I'm not sure. I want to dismiss my pet but I don't want to permanently lose it.

They are only an extra, like the reskins for the horse, but the pets don't do nothing especial (they have specific animations) Just don't equip your pet, no need to delete or something else. If you want the pets that can carry your stuff, you can buy 2 of those, a pig and a rat in the crownstore.

Just to clarify:

The pig and the rat do not literally carry your items, they simply each increase the maximum carrying capacity of each current or future character on your account on that platform/server, by 5 slots. If you have both, you can upgrade up to 210 slots.

This increase happens upon purchase of the pet, and you actually do not need to ever use the pet on even a single character.

even without eso+ inventory can be managed, it takes time and gold. expanded(bought -pack merchant and mount training) max character slots is something like 200, bank 240, storage crates 1x30 obtained through lvl-ing, 3x30 and 3x60 obtained through crown store or in-game through tel var stones(imperial city) or master crafting writs(max crafting skill) + alt characters and bank used for crafting materials. also waiting for eso+ free days to transfer your crafting mats to crafting bag or taking from time to time eso+ which can be useful especially when lvl-ing crafting on character. and with upcoming update even armors wouldn't be necessary to keep all as they will be craftable (even now you can buy armors from guild merchants just some costs too much).
